Howe Top House occupies a wonderful position, elevated above picturesque Maulds Meaburn, with wide ranging views over the village and adjoining countryside. Built around 10 years ago, it is a substantial contemporary house with extensive and flexible family accommodation, gardens, a stone outbuilding and parking for several cars. On the ground floor, entering through the porch, with a boot room, you encounter the lovely large entrance hall which has a cloakroom to the right and views to the other end of the property. This leads directly into the magnificent open plan dining kitchen with an oak floor, which is the heart of the house. With multiple windows this is a stylish and light family entertaining space, with great views. This has an adjacent pantry which leads into the fitted utility room. It also opens through double doors into the snug or garden room, with a wood burner, and glazed doors out to the garden. This has been designed to bring light and the views into the property. Off the entrance hall are two further reception rooms, the lounge with picture windows and feature open fireplace. A home office or study completes this level. On the first floor, up the oak staircase, we find the bedroom accommodation. There are five double bedrooms altogether, all with lovely views, with three bath or shower rooms. The master bedroom, with french doors out to a south facing balcony, has the same great views out southwards as the garden room. It extends to an impressive full suite, including an ensuite bathroom with separate double walk in shower and a dressing room. There is second ensuite bedroom with a shower room and the remaining three bedrooms are served by the house bathroom which also has a walk in shower, double ended bath and oak flooring. There is good outside space which includes enclosed lawned gardens and a vegetable plot, a decked verandah for outside entertaining and alfresco dining and a log store; also that pretty stone period outbuilding. There is ample parking for cars and the footings have been constructed for the building of a double garage, allowing for that future development if desired. Page 5 of 12
